Dear ERT Project Manager and/or Research Advisor

As you well know, this is the time for developing the Statements of Work (SOW) for the ERT Cooperative Agreements (or Inter Agency Agreements) for the ERT projects for FY99.

You have probably heard that the Space Station Program managers are in Russia negotiating a new Assembly Sequence (Rev E). The Rev E sequence being negotiated only covers the period through Flight 7A. However, I have received instructions from the Station Payload manager to build the ERT program schedules assuming a slip of about 7 months. In further discussions with Station managers I have found out that the probable slips to the ERT flights are as follows:

ACESE manifested on Flight 13A from 6/2001 to 3/2002 a slip of 9 months
ODC manifested on Flight UF4 from 5/2002 to 11/2002 a slip of 6 months
PET (not manifested) on Flight 2JA from 6/2002 to 1/2003 a slip of 7 months
FLEX and MADE (not manifested) on Flight UF6 from 9/2003 to 6/2004 a slip of 9 months

As you also probably know, to cover the Russian economic situation, the SSPO is also going to provide Russia with about $660M over the next four years. There will be a $60M payoff by the end of this month, and then 4 yearly installments of $150M. Furthermore, Code M management has decided that the entire FY99 installment ($150M) will come out of the FY99 Research Programs. As a result, the ERT Research Program FY99 budget mark has been reduced substantially. I have made, with the approval of the SSPO Payloads Office, some decisions that are critical to each of the projects. I understand that some of you will be upset at this latest budget and I understand. I want to state that the ERT program has received a relatively minor cut in funding when compared with some of the other ISS research programs.

So, as we approach October 1st, please send me an SOW that will be commensurate with the work that can be done with the following budget marks for FY99.

ACESE $4000K
ODC $ 982K
PET $358K
FLEX $100K
MADE $100K
